Electrical and electronic waste is a growing problem as volumes are increasing fast. Rapid product innovation and replacement, especially in information and communication technologies (ICT), combined with the migration from analog to digital technologies and to flat-screen televisions and monitors has resulted in some electronic products quickly reaching the end of their life. The EU directive on waste electrical and electronic equipment (WEEE) aims to minimise WEEE by putting organizational and financial responsibility on producers and distributors for collection, treatment, recycling and recovery of WEEE. Therefore all stakeholders need to be well-informed about their WEEE responsibilities and options. The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ment (WEEE) Regulations (S.I. 2006/3289, ISBN 9780110754796) introduce a new legal framework for the disposal of electrical and electronic equipment by householders and non-household users. This guidance document explains the requirements of the WEEE Regulations and how they affect NHS trusts as users of non-household equipment. Issues covered include: the objectives and scope of the Regulations; key dates and deadlines; links between procurement and disposal; the need to track EEE purchases made at a department/ward level; considerations involved in accepting end-of-life responsibility from producers in new procurement; and links with other waste management legislation.

This project identifies improvements in plastics recycling from Nordic electronic waste. Limited improvement is possible through modest changes in the existing value chain, such as ensuring that wastes are directed as intended. But for the most part, enhanced plastics recycling implies higher costs. The necessary changes could be driven in part through revised policy and regulatory instruments. These changes might, in turn, encourage more positive engagement from electronics producers.
